Inga Orekhova (born 10 November 1989) is a Ukrainian professional basketball player who last played for the Connecticut Sun of the WNBA.[1] The Dream waived her in early June.[2] On May 14, 2015, Orekhova signed with the Connecticut Sun[3]

Orekhova played basketball at The Bishop's School in La Jolla, California, where she graduated in 2010.[4][5]
